Output 58d79309bac262d2e9cfb60cc088a2534f9d0791c8d52c02adccdb3d63aae23f:0

value
10073921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2f8503cd806340ada72bd0d76116cfbf784a424 OP_EQUAL
address
3LvXHwv2hMJRnmwBANhaQiNSG86Xk8WZGT
transaction
58d79309bac262d2e9cfb60cc088a2534f9d0791c8d52c02adccdb3d63aae23f
spent
false